RF IDeas Inc., a leading manufacturer of in-building identification and access readers, announced today that the pcProx® Plus family of readers has undergone an expansion that will provide the ability to read the secure sector memory areas of HID iCLASS ID™ and iCLASS SE™ credentials.
By expanding the pcProx Plus family, customers now have more custom features to choose from to better fit their specific authentication needs, as well as have the ability to take advantage of enhanced security benefits. When an iCLASS SE card is used in conjunction with the newest pcProx Plus reader, it provides the most secure proximity combination available on the market.
"Our goal with the pcProx Plus reader was to offer a powerful and diverse card reader that would meet all of our customers’ needs, while remaining cost effective and simple to use,” says Richard Landuyt, President of RF IDeas. "This expansion of the pcProx Plus line takes that goal to the next level by providing our customers with more diverse and customizable features that can be used to best suit their application.”
The RF IDeas pcProx and pcProx Plus lines of card readers currently support over 45 different types of proximity (125 kHz) and contactless (13.56 MHz) credentials. The addition of the iCLASS ID and iCLASS SE capabilities create a powerful and versatile ecosystem for all RF IDeas customers.
About RF IDeas:
RF IDeas, founded in 1995, is the innovator of WaveID®, the new standard for badge-based authentication and identification solutions powered by RF IDeas readers. Under the WaveID umbrella, RF IDeas designs, develops, and manufactures a complete line of pcProx® card readers that support nearly every proximity and contactless smart card in use worldwide. RF IDeas readers come in many form factors and are used in numerous applications and OEM solutions including: multi-function printers, kiosks, building and door access, point-of-sale, attendance management and computer logon. In addition to pcProx readers, RF IDeas also offers magnetic stripe card readers, Wiegand Converters and Software Developer's Kits.
Inc. magazine ranked RF IDeas No. 13 in the Computer Hardware Industry on its Inc. 500|5000 list, an exclusive ranking of the nation's fastest-growing private companies.
